3 When Herod the king had heard these things, he was troubled and all Jerusalem with him.

4 And having assembled all the chief priests and scribes of the people, he demanded of them, Where the Christ was to be born?

5 And they said to him, In Bethlehem of Judea; for thus it is written by the prophet, And thou,

6 Bethlehem in the land of Judah, art in no wise the least among the princes of Judah; for out of thee shall come forth a Ruler, who shall feed my people Israel.

7 Then Herod, having privately called the wise men, inquired of them with great exactness, at what time the star appeared:

8 And sending them to Bethlehem, he said, Go, inquire exactly concerning the young child, and if ye find him, bring me word again, that I also may come and worship him.
